My dealer says there's still time to change my color, and I can't f-ing decide between these two.

On one hand, EG looks very classic Bronco, and it really shines in the sun. Downsides is that every other Bronco in my area is the same color, and it looks pretty dull on cloudy days.

Velocity blue looks great. Really love the color, loses a lot of the "classic" look of the green though. Much bolder color, which I like. I also *very* rarely see this color on the streets, only a handful of times ever even though it's been around longer than EG.

Super, super torn. Every time I see a photo of an EG green in the sun I'm like, that's the color! Then I see a SAS Velocity Blue and I'm just in love with how great it looks.

Someone guide me in the right direction. I miss Cyber Orange, that was an easy choice on the 2 doors.

The blue is a little bright when clean but looks awesome when dirty. The green looks great when clean but subdued when dirty. I run a dirty rig all the time, so VB for me.
